Posted by zoric on Jan-01-2007 17:03:

I think West Ham will struggle even more then they've done so far after this loss.

Curbishley will have to find a new way of forming the defence because they were absolutely useless tonight against Reading. Reading on the other hand is playing impressive and respectless against their opponents.

West Ham has 33 allowed goals after tonights game, while they've scored 12 goals (Watford on 12 goals aswell) on 22 played games. Worst in the whole EPL after Charlton (36 allowed goals).

Reading on the other hand has 30 goals scored and 30 goals allowed, while they land on a 9th place in the EPL after 22 played games.
